Ethereum
Block
21186466
0x429367b3bfcbbfcd5600124586d80308c43a56ee
EOA
Active on
Ethereum with -- and
1 txns
Funded by
0x26fa
…
3646
via
0x3bc5
…
5955
First active
7 years ago
Last active
7 years ago
Loading...